Magnetic Circular Dichroism Elucidates Molecular Interactions in Aggregated Chiral Organic Materials

Alessio Gabbani,
Andrea Taddeucci,
Marco Bertuolo
et al.

Abstract: Chiral materials formed by aggregated organic compounds play a fundamental role in chiral optoelectronics, photo‐ and spin‐tronics. Nonetheless, a precise understanding of the molecular interactions involved remains an open problem. Here we introduce magnetic circular dichroism (MCD) as a new tool to elucidate molecular interactions and structural parameters of a supramolecular system.
